Makeshift fix is a wire mesh surround standing at least 4" off the feeder, so the Ibis can't just poke his/her beak in and hoover up the snacks.
Alternatively, find cheap food that you can leave on the ground for the Ibises, so they leave the feeders alone for the other birds.
